From Monday, the reception desk in Halloway House moves from the mezzanine to the ground floor, beside the main revolving doors. For the night shift, this changes the sign-in routine: all after-hours visitors must now be met at the ground-floor desk, and the mezzanine barrier will stay locked overnight. Deliveries still go through the rear dock. The old desk phone will be disconnected Friday. To open the new ground-floor staff gate during the move, use the code below.

door code, yagap-bahof: bdg-O-05

Spreadsheet exports in Gridforge stream rows; do not buffer the full workbook. Plugins that materialize all cells will be killed at 512 MB. Use the chunked writer API and flush every 10k rows. Formula cells are evaluated lazily — forcing evaluation in a loop is the top memory offender we see from third-party plugins. Test against the hosted profiler before submitting. The profiler endpoint is internal; plugin authors get scoped access using the key below.

service key, fawip-bajef: kto11_Qt5wZK9vdNC

Re: rollout framework PR — the new percentage-bucketing logic in Flagpole looks correct, but support should know the ramp steps changed. Tickets about users flipping between variants are expected during the 10%–25% window; that's by design, not a bug. Escalate only if churn persists past an hour. For reference, here are the current ramp constants.

constants for bagag-fawip:
BUDGETS = {
    "wenius": 400,
    "brieth": 224,
    "rusath": 783,
    "eliys": 187,
    "aldax": 737,
    "ralion": 818,
    "istius": 153,
}

## InkPress Environments

InkPress renders PDF invoices for the Brindlevale billing stack. There are three environments: dev, staging, and prod, each with its own font cache and render queue. If prod rendering stalls, check staging first — it usually drifts the same way. When restarting the renderer, it picks up everything from its config at boot, which currently looks like this.

deployment values, fahap-hahaf:
[casdor]
port = 9200
region = south-2
host = casdor.qirvanworks.corp
timeout_ms = 3000
retries = 4